About the job
Job Title: Graduate Engineer
Reporting to: Technical Director
Main Purpose
This two-year graduate programme offers exposure to the full lifecycle of renewable
energy projects—from early feasibility and design through construction, commissioning
and operations. Working alongside experienced engineers, you will gain hands-on
technical experience and a broad understanding of the commercial, regulatory and
environmental aspects of the UK energy market.
Key Tasks and Requirements
• Support site feasibility studies, resource assessments and grid connection
applications in line with UK DNOs/NESO requirements.
• Assist in the preparation and review of engineering drawings, specifications and
tender documentation.
• Contribute to energy yield modelling (e.g. PVsyst, WindPro) and performance
analysis.
• Provide on-site support during construction, commissioning and acceptance testing.
• Monitor operational assets and help identify performance improvement
opportunities.
• Prepare technical reports, risk assessments, and health & safety documentation in
accordance with UK CDM Regulations.
• Liaise with internal teams, contractors, consultants and stakeholders including
Ofgem, local councils and network operators.
• Keep abreast of UK energy policy, industry standards and emerging renewable
technologies

Guidance on Skills for Job
• Degree (2:1 or above) in Electrical, Mechanical, Civil, Renewable Energy or related
Engineering discipline (or equivalent).
• Strong interest in the UK renewable sector and the transition to net zero.
• Competent user of MS Office; familiarity with CAD, GIS or modelling software is
advantageous.
• Excellent analytical, problem-solving and communication skills.
• Flexible and willing to travel to project sites across the UK.
• Eligibility to work in the UK and a full UK driving licence preferred.
